  2. Mary, Lady Stewart (born Mary Florence Elinor Rainbow; 17 September 1916 – 9 May 2014) was a British novelist who developed the romantic mystery genre, featuring smart, adventurous heroines who could hold their own in dangerous situations.

Aug 11, 2020 · Mary Stewart is a mid-century British author who helped establish the romantic suspense genre in the 1950s, and contributed to the resurgence of the fantasy novel in the 1970s with her Merlin trilogy.
